Manchester City: Tyrick Mitchell being considered by Cityzens

Manchester City are considering a move for Crystal Palace full-back Tyrick Mitchell, according to Spanish outlet Mundo Deportivo

The lowdown: Replacement could be needed…

This comes amidst enhanced speculation surrounding the long-term future of left-back Oleksandr Zinchenko at the Etihad Stadium.

Already linked with Arsenal and West Ham United, the versatile Ukrainian could be seeking pastures new this summer. having struggled to hold down a regular place in Pep Guardiola’s plans.

It now seems as though there could be interest coming from abroad, as City eye up an exciting potential successor…

The latest: Mitchell considered by Man City

As per Mundo Deportivo, Man City are ‘considering the possibility of signing’ the 22-year-old Eagles defender.

It’s claimed that Barcelona are looking at signing Zinchenko and, as such, the Citizens may move for Palace’s twice-capped England international.

Dubbed a ‘silent assassin’ by former academy coach Stuart English, Mitchell has graduated through the youth ranks at Selhurst Park and is now an established member of Patrick Vieira’s side.

The verdict: Natural progression

A naturally attack-minded left-back who has played as a left-sided midfielder on occasion, signing the talented English youngster would be a superb replacement if Zinchenko leaves, as Guardiola looks to develop the City squad once again.

In 2021/22, the Londoner provided two assists in 42 appearances across all competitions for Palace, earning a 6.87 Sofascore rating whilst making 2.9 tackles, 2.3 clearances and 1.1 interceptions per game in the process. That highlights his defensive acumen in a team which requires its full-backs to perform such duties.
